Recap: Hillsboro Christian Academy Crusaders vs. Varsity Opponent
The Hillsboro Christian Academy Crusaders's game on Saturday was a tough lo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Tuesday. They blew past Varsity Opponent 39-13.
Hillsboro Christian Academy found their leader in underclassman Emma Korte, who dropped a double-double on 10 points and 13 rebounds. That makes it two consecutive games in which Korte has scored at least 25% of Hillsboro Christian Academy's points. Another player making a difference was Annie Henderson, who scored 8 points along with 8 rebounds and 3 steals.
Hillsboro Christian Academy now has a winning record of 2-1. As for Varsity Opponent, they have not been sharp recently, as they've lost 23 of their last 25 games, which put a noticeable dent in their 11-61 record this season.
Hillsboro Christian Academy will head out on the road to face off against Milford Christian at 4:30 p.m. on December 1st. As for Varsity Opponent, they will take on Central Pointe Christian Academy at 7:45 p.m. on Tuesday.
